Under NJSA 26:3D-55, New Jersey prohibits the sale, gift, or distribution of tobacco and electronic smoking products to anyone under 21, with retailer civil penalties for violations.

New Jersey raised the legal tobacco purchase age to 21 in 2017 under NJ Β§2C:33-13.1, predating federal Tobacco 21. Newark retailers must verify ID for all tobacco, vape, and nicotine product sales to anyone appearing under 30.

Does this apply to military personnel under 21?
No exception in NJ law. Some federal-base exchanges may differ, but civilian retailers in Newark must enforce the 21 minimum regardless of military status.
Are synthetic-nicotine vapes covered?
Yes. NJ Β§2C:33-13.1 was amended to include any nicotine-containing product, including synthetic and tobacco-derived varieties, closing the prior loophole.
